六、03【Java 多线程】之Java线程
Java 创建线程的方式 Java创建线程有四种方式: 继承 Thread 类 实现 Runnable 接口 实现 Callable 接口 使用 Executors 工具类创建线程池 1)继承 Thread 类 创建一个类继承 Thread,重新run()方法。run() 方法就是线程要执行的业务逻辑方法。 将该类进行实例化,调用 star() 方法来启动线程。 public class MyTh…
Java 创建线程的方式 Java创建线程有四种方式: 继承 Thread 类 实现 Runnable 接口 实现 Callable 接口 使用 Executors 工具类创建线程池 1)继承 Thread 类 创建一个类继承 Thread,重新run()方法。run() 方法就是线程要执行的业务逻辑方法。 将该类进行实例化,调用 star() 方法来启动线程。 public class MyTh…
文章目录 1 数组 2 可变数组 1 数组 数组定义 方式一: int num[10]; for (int i=0;i<10;i++) { num[i]=0; } 定义了10个变量,使用之前需要初始化,在内存中的存储空间是连续的。 num[0]、num[1]…num[9] 方式二: 定义与初始化一起做了。 int num[] = {1,3,5,7,9}; int num[10] = {2,3…
很多人都知道苹果手机可以选择动态壁纸,那你知道到怎么将有趣的视频为动态壁纸吗?不知道的小伙伴快来看看吧! 方法一:短视频动态壁纸 我们在刷抖音的时候经常看到很多很好看或者有趣的视频,其实这些都可以作为动态壁纸。 1、打开抖音,选择一个你喜欢的视频,点击分享按钮,然后左滑找到并点击动态壁纸,动态壁纸就会保存到相册了; 2、打开设置,点击墙纸,然后点击选取新的墙纸; 3、选中刚才保存的动态壁纸,然后点…
做过项目的人都明白,项目实施时间一般很长,在实施期间总有很多项目结果不尽人意的问题。要使一个项目取得成功,就要结合很多因素一起才能作用,其中做好项目成本的管理就是最重要的步骤之一,下面列出了常见的项目成本管理误区,以及解决方案。 以下是管理项目成本时存在的一些常见误区: 忽视风险成本 :在项目成本计划中,可能会忽视风险管理带来的成本。项目中的不确定性和风险可能会增加成本,如果不考虑这些成本,就会导…
Android Studio打不开,无法启动,无反应的解决方案 参考文章: (1)Android Studio打不开,无法启动,无反应的解决方案 (2)https://www.cnblogs.com/smallerpig/archive/2013/05/22/3646081.html (3)https://www.javazxz.com/thread-2061-1-1.html 备忘一下。
https://www.zlib.net/crc_v3.txt A PAINLESS GUIDE TO CRC ERROR DETECTION ALGORITHMS ================================================== "Everything you wanted to know about CRC algorithms, but were afra…
在大型的分布式系统中,经常会涉及到状态的改变,这里的状态变化可以分很多种,最极端的情况是,任何状态之间都可以互相切换。 这种状态之间的切换,转变,更加官方一点的称为叫状态机。这个词可能很多人会感到比较陌生,英文就是State Machine。 所以如果大家在学习开源项目中,看到这个单词,指的就是状态机的意思。那么状态机有什么用途呢,为什么我们要定义这样一个概念呢? 本文笔者就来简单聊聊状态机的管理…